I recall a few years back when we were designing the collection for Amarra, I emphasized the incorporation of sustainable materials and ethical processes. This was at a time when sustainable fashion was not the popular trend it is now. I was observing an incremental awareness in consumers towards environment-friendly products in other domains, and I had a gut feeling that it would permeate into fashion too. We aligned our merchandising accordingly, sourcing sustainable fabrics, ensuring ethical manufacture, and marketing our approach prominently. Fast forward a year, and there was a wave of sustainable fashion that swept the industry. We were not only prepared but had positioned Amarra as a frontrunner in this shift. This decision successfully boosted our brand identity as well as sales, teaching us the significant impact of forecasting trends in fashion merchandising.
While founding and running USAPromDress.com, I closely followed fashion trends and successfully forecasted a shift in demand for prom dresses. By analyzing Google Search data, customer feedback, and social media trends, I predicted a rising demand for vintage-inspired dresses. This encouraged me to adjust our merchandising strategy and focus on stocking an extensive range of vintage-style prom dresses. This proactive shift proved tremendously effective. We saw our daily visitor traffic significantly increase from two to one hundred visitors, solidifying the effectiveness of our data analytics strategies in fashion trend forecasting. Being ahead of the curve in predicting and reacting to this fashion shift turned out to be a decisive factor in our e-commerce success.

In the competitive realm of fashion merchandising, anticipating trend shifts is essential. Around 2019, data showed a growing consumer preference for sustainable fashion, particularly among millennials and Gen Z who value environmental impact. A mid-sized fashion brand, initially focused on fast fashion, adapted by investing in sustainable practices, demonstrating the importance of aligning merchandising strategies with evolving consumer values to maintain market relevance.
